Eight Sleep is the first sleep fitness company. At Eight Sleep we design products at the forefront of sleep innovation. Our mission is to power human potential through better sleep, using innovative technology, detailed design, and proven science and data to personalize and improve each night for everybody—changing the way people sleep forever and for better. Backed by leading Silicon Valley investors including Khosla Ventures and Y Combinator, it was named by Fast Company in 2018 as one of the Most Innovative Companies in Consumer Electronics.
We've just launched our temperature-regulated smart bed, the Pod. It's an absolute game changer, improving people's health and happiness by changing the way they sleep. Early feedback is great, but we still have a long way to go toward achieving our mission.
That is why we are looking for a Data Engineer who can run data engineering systems in production in their sleep and who is seeking an opportunity to work at an extremely high scale to build stats- and ML-powered features and pipelines. Using the the best tools available, you will harness the high volume of heterogeneous complex data we collect to help change the way people sleep.
How you'll contribute:
- Write data applications to apply ML and statistical algorithms to enormous amounts of data for product features
- Generally contribute to improving the health and value of our data ecosystem through finding and building the best tools and infrastructure
- Work all over the stack, moving fluidly between programming languages: Python, Node, Rust, c++ and more
- Join a small, excellent team solving hard problems the right way
- Ship code frequently, own meaningful parts of our service, have an impact, and grow with the company
What you'll need to succeed:
- B.S. or higher in Computer Science (or equivalent work experience)
- 5+ years of data/backend engineering experience working on large scale systems (especially for machine learning pipelines, or an eagerness to learn how to build them)
- You have built and operated data-intensive applications for real customers in production systems
- Experience in either node (typescript) or python, along with at least two of the following: Java, c++, c#, go, rust, as well as a willingness to pick up other languages as needed
- Experience with software engineering best practices (e.g. unit testing, code reviews, design documentation)
- Experience with Docker and Kubernetes or AWS ECS
- You want to work in a fast, high growth startup environment with lots of independence and responsibility
- You enjoy working with enormous amounts of data
- You have done ops and know what goes wrong in production
Bonus Points:
- Experience with Cassandra, Hbase, DynamoDB and other horizontally scalable storage systems is a plus
- You have experience with stream data processing with either Kinesis or Kafka
- Experience with embedded development is a plus
Why you'll love Eight Sleep:
- We’re a tight-knit, passionate team that’s working to improve people’s lives by improving the way they sleep
- Leadership is committed to employees’ wellness and career development
- You’ll get a better night sleep every night; all full-time employees receive the Pod
- Flexible, generous PTO
- 100% employer contribution for medical/dental/vision insurance
- Discounted gym memberships, commuter benefits
- Weekly team happy hours and lunches
- Office snacks
At Eight Sleep we continually celebrate the diverse community different individuals cultivate. As an equal opportunity employer, we stay true to our values by ensuring everyone feels they can flourish and grow. We are committed to equal employment opportunity regardless of race, color, ancestry, religion, sex, national origin, sexual orientation, age, citizenship, marital status, disability, gender identity or Veteran status.
Read Full Job Description